{"data":{"id":"us-ky/krs-251.650","jurisdiction":"us-ky","citation":"KRS 251.650","heading":"Use of funds -- Kentucky grain insurance fund -- Investment of funds --","body":"Authorization for funds to be invested through the Finance and\nAdministration Cabinet's Office of Financial Management -- Board to report\nto Interim Joint Committee on Approp riations and Revenue and to Interim\nJoint Committee on Agriculture in each odd-numbered year.\n(1) The total value of assessments shall be deposited and held by the board in trust in\nthe Kentucky grain insurance fund to pay valid claims under the provisio ns of this\nsection and KRS 251.400. These funds shall be invested and reinvested in United\nStates Treasury obligations at the direction of the board, and the interest from these\ninvestments shall be deposited to the credit of the fund and shall be available for the\nsame purposes as all other money deposited in the fund. The money in the fund\nshall not be available for any purpose other than the payment of claims in\naccordance with KRS 251.400, refunds, legal fees, management fees, investment\nfees, and administration fees that are approved by the board. No money in this fund\nshall be used for any regulatory or licensing provision in this chapter.\n(2) Notwithstanding the provisions of subsection (1) of this section, the board may\nauthorize the investment of funds for the Kentucky grain insurance fund through the\nFinance and Administration Cabinet's Office of Financial Management in any\nguaranteed security or other guaranteed investment recommended by the office if\nthe board determines the recommendation would maximize the interest or income to\nthe fund.\n(3) By October 1 of each odd-numbered year, the board shall report to the Interim Joint\nCommittee on Appropriations and Revenue and the Interim Joint Committee on\nAgriculture:\n(a) The current balance of the fund;\n(b) The amount of assessments, interest earned, and any other money deposited\ninto the fund; and\n(c) The expenditures incurred due to claims, refunds, management fees,\ninvestment fees, legal fees, and administrative fees.\n(4) Each report shall reflect the deposits into and the expenditures incurred for the most\nrecent biennium.","path":["KRS Chapter 251"],"source_url":"https://apps.legislature.ky.gov/law/statutes/statute.aspx?id=49428","current_through":"Includes enactments through the 2026 Regular Session","vintage":"09/05/2026","retrieved_at":"2026-09-05T20:53:05Z","sha256":"3ba7058e45a4f267cd6fdda41b382cf17b16480ac132a2b26dba7c77b2ceac7c","source_id":"us-ky","stale":false,"prev":"us-ky/krs-251.642","next":"us-ky/krs-251.660"},"notice":"GroundRules: Original legal text.
